Fallen Tree Removal in Aiken, SC
Fallen tree removal services involve safely and efficiently removing trees that have fallen due to storms, decay, or other causes. This process typically includes assessing the site, dismantling the tree if necessary, and removing all debris to restore safety and accessibility to the property. Homeowners often request this service when a tree poses a hazard to structures, pathways, or power lines, or when fallen branches block driveways and yards. It’s important for property owners to understand the extent of the damage, the potential risks involved, and any necessary preparations before requesting removal, such as clearing the area or identifying valuable or delicate landscaping nearby.
These services cover a range of projects, from removing individual fallen trees to clearing large amounts of debris after severe weather events. Property owners should consider factors like the size and location of the fallen tree, potential obstacles, and the presence of nearby structures or utilities. Understanding these details helps ensure the removal process is safe and effective, and that the property is restored promptly. Contacting a professional for assessment can provide clarity on the scope of work needed and help plan for proper cleanup and disposal.

Fallen Tree Removal Questions
What signs indicate a fallen or damaged tree? Signs include leaning branches, cracked or split trunks, and visible root damage near the base of the tree.
Is it safe to remove a fallen tree myself? Removing a fallen tree can be dangerous; it is recommended to seek professional assistance for safe and proper removal.
What types of trees are typically removed? Commonly removed trees include dead, diseased, or storm-damaged trees that pose a risk to property or safety.
How does fallen tree removal impact the landscape? Proper removal helps prevent further damage and prepares the area for cleanup or new planting as needed.
